Solana Tokenized Equities Reach $684 Million

Solana’s tokenized-equity market has reached a new all-time high of approximately $684 million, highlighting the rapid expansion of blockchain-based exposure to traditional stocks.

The latest data shows tokenized-equity supply on Solana has increased 47% in roughly three weeks, as new assets and trading venues continue to expand the ecosystem.

The growth comes as companies including Sunrise and Backpack Securities continue adding tokenized stocks to Solana, giving eligible users access to blockchain-based representations of traditional equities.

At the same time, tokenized stocks are increasingly being positioned for 24/7 trading, allowing market activity to continue outside conventional U.S. stock-market hours.

New Stock Listings Expand Solana's Tokenized Market

The latest expansion includes tokenized exposure to a growing range of publicly traded companies.

Recent additions reported across the Solana ecosystem include Nike (NKE), Grindr (GRND), Hertz (HTZ), Sphere Entertainment (SPHR), Wendy's (WEN), Krispy Kreme (DNUT) and DraftKings (DKNG).

Backpack Securities has also been expanding its tokenized-stock infrastructure on Solana. Its platform describes tokenized securities as assets that can be held in self-custody, transferred between wallets and traded around the clock.

This growing selection gives investors access to a wider range of traditional companies through blockchain infrastructure.

24/7 Trading Becomes a Key Feature

One of the biggest differences between tokenized equities and traditional stock markets is trading availability.

Blockchain networks operate continuously, allowing eligible tokenized securities to be traded beyond standard exchange hours.

Backpack says its tokenized securities support 24/7 trading, while its broader brokerage platform also promotes round-the-clock access to U.S. equities.

Recent market activity demonstrates the scale of this emerging model. On September 12, Solana reportedly recorded around $200 million in tokenized-equity trading volume in a single day, while total tokenized-equity supply reached approximately $684 million the following day.

Solana's RWA Ecosystem Continues to Expand

The tokenized-equity milestone is part of a broader expansion of real-world assets on Solana.

The Solana Foundation reported that the network's RWA value surpassed $4 billion, with more than 350,000 addresses holding tokenized real-world assets. It also reported that, as of late July, approximately 97% of cumulative onchain tokenized-equity spot volume had settled on Solana.

Solana's RWA ecosystem includes more than equities. The network also supports tokenized Treasuries, funds, ETFs, commodities and other financial assets.

This diversification is turning tokenization into a broader component of Solana's financial infrastructure rather than a single-product market.

Backpack Expands Tokenized Equity Infrastructure

Backpack Securities has become one of the companies helping drive Solana's tokenized-equity growth.

The platform launched tokenized securities on Solana in partnership with Sunrise, with assets designed to provide blockchain-based exposure to underlying securities.

Individual products have included tokenized Micron Technology ($MU), where each token is described as redeemable 1:1 for the underlying Micron share through Backpack Securities.

More recently, Backpack introduced tokenized Strategy Inc. ($MSTR), with the asset designed to be redeemable 1:1 for an MSTR share and tradable 24/7 on Solana.

The growing number of listings demonstrates how tokenized equities are moving toward a broader, multi-asset market.

Why Tokenized Stocks Matter

Tokenized equities can combine traditional financial exposure with blockchain infrastructure.

Potential advantages include:

  • 24/7 trading

  • Faster settlement

  • Wallet-based asset ownership

  • Fractional access where supported

  • Global distribution subject to regulatory restrictions

  • Integration with blockchain applications

  • Programmable financial assets

The ability to trade tokenized securities outside traditional market hours is particularly important for global users.

However, tokenized stocks do not necessarily provide identical rights to conventional shares. Depending on the issuer and structure, token holders may not receive the same voting rights or other shareholder benefits associated with traditional stock ownership. Reuters recently highlighted these differences as one of the challenges facing the broader tokenized-equity market.

Traditional Financial Markets Are Also Moving Onchain

The expansion of Solana's tokenized-equity market comes as traditional financial institutions increasingly explore blockchain-based securities infrastructure.

In September, Nasdaq announced a $100 million investment in Payward, the parent company of Kraken, as part of a partnership focused on developing infrastructure for tokenized equities. Nasdaq said the initiative is aimed at supporting the distribution, trading and post-trade functions of tokenized securities.

The development illustrates that tokenization is no longer limited to crypto-native companies.

Major financial-market operators are increasingly exploring blockchain technology as another infrastructure layer for securities trading and settlement.

Tokenized Equity Market Still Has Challenges

Despite rapid growth, the tokenized-stock market remains relatively small compared with traditional equity markets.

Reuters recently estimated the broader digital-equity market at roughly $3 billion, compared with the multi-trillion-dollar traditional equity market. The report also highlighted concerns around fragmented liquidity, regulatory compliance, shareholder rights and price discovery.

These challenges mean that tokenized equities are still an emerging market.

For Solana, however, the rapid increase in tokenized-equity supply and trading activity demonstrates that blockchain-based securities are becoming a meaningful part of the network's ecosystem.
